Craigslist Adult Services Censored by Government

8 September, 2010 (14:24) | Uncategorized | By: Tobi Hill-Meyer

Over this last weekend, those who relied upon Cragslist adult services got a rude awakening. Without any warning, and with no official statement yet, Craigslist removed the adult services section from all US sites and replaced it with a small censored image.

The Advocate Thinks I’m Brianna Freeman

20 June, 2010 (13:50) | Uncategorized | By: Tobi Hill-Meyer

Last week a story a story went around the blogosphere of Brianna Freeman, a 45 year old trans woman in Maine, who was suing Denny’s after a manager refused to let her use the restroom. The Advocate ran the story last Friday and – apparently figuring that one trans woman’s picture was as good [...]
